技术文摘
读取和修改HTML DOM元素property属性的方法
读取和修改HTML DOM元素property属性的方法
在网页开发中,对HTML DOM(文档对象模型)元素的操作至关重要。其中,读取和修改元素的property属性是常见的需求,它能为网页带来动态交互和个性化的展示效果。
读取HTML DOM元素的property属性相对简单。要获取到目标元素。可以使用多种方法,比如通过元素的ID,使用document.getElementById('elementId');通过标签名,使用document.getElementsByTagName('tagName');通过类名,使用document.getElementsByClassName('className')等。获取到元素后,就可以直接访问其property属性。例如,对于一个<input>元素,要获取其value属性的值,可以这样做:
const inputElement = document.getElementById('myInput');
const inputValue = inputElement.value;
console.log(inputValue);
这里,inputElement就是获取到的<input>元素,value就是它的一个property属性,通过直接访问就得到了输入框中的值。
而修改HTML DOM元素的property属性,同样需要先获取目标元素。假设要修改一个<img>元素的src属性,以更换图片:
const imgElement = document.getElementById('myImage');
imgElement.src = 'newImage.jpg';
上述代码先获取到ID为myImage的<img>元素,然后通过直接赋值的方式,将src属性修改为newImage.jpg,页面上的图片就会相应地更换。
对于一些布尔类型的property属性,比如<input type="checkbox">的checked属性,修改起来也很方便。若要将一个复选框设置为选中状态:
const checkboxElement = document.getElementById('myCheckbox');
checkboxElement.checked = true;
通过对DOM元素property属性的读取和修改,我们可以实现很多有趣的功能。比如根据用户的操作动态更新页面内容,实现页面的交互效果等。掌握这些方法,能让开发者更加灵活地控制网页的展示和行为,为用户带来更好的体验。无论是简单的表单验证,还是复杂的单页面应用开发,对DOM元素property属性的操作都是不可或缺的基础技能。
TAGS: 修改方法 读取方法 property属性 HTML DOM元素
- Spring AOP 中被代理的对象是否一定为单例
- Promise 与 Async/Await 的差异
- Optional 助力优雅规避空指针异常
- 无代码编程会成为未来趋势吗?是事实吗?
- 20 个 Git 基本命令:开发人员必备
- Python Web 开发工具探秘:哪个框架才是你的最佳选择?
- 九款前端开发的 Python 框架:JavaScript 的替代选择
- Docker 容器网络性能的测试与调优策略
- XGBoost 2.0:基于树的方法重大更新来袭
- 面试官:掌握 JVM 中判定对象已死的关键知识
- 归并排序的深度剖析:原理、性能解析及 Java 实现
- 超越 React ,JS 代码体积骤减 90%!它缘何成为 2023 年最佳 Web 框架?
- Kubernetes 新手完备指引
- 浅析 C#归并排序算法
- 更强有力的 React 错误处理手段!